WebNov 26, 2015 · Tire manufacturers (and tire standards, for the most part) are careful to subtract any possible aerodynamic loss of the tire when measuring rolling resistance, because the aerodynamic loss of the tire is highly dependent on the vehicle airflow and aerodynamic design, which cannot be predicted by the tire manufacturers.

WebThe rolling resistance coefficient (RRC) indicates the amount of force required to overcome the hysteresis of the material as the tire rolls. Tire pressure, vehicle weight and velocity all play a role in how much force is lost to rolling resistance.
